      Currently, PVFs are re-prepared if any execution environment parameter
      changes. As we've recently seen on Kusama and Polkadot, that may lead to
      a severe finality lag because every validator has to re-prepare every
      PVF. That cannot be avoided altogether; however, we could cease
      re-preparing PVFs when a change in the execution environment can't lead
      to a change in the artifact itself. For example, it's clear that
      changing the execution timeout cannot affect the artifact.
      
      In this PR, I'm introducing a separate hash for the subset of execution
      environment parameters that changes only if a preparation-related
      parameter changes. It introduces some minor code duplication, but
      without that, the scope of changes would be much bigger.

      After the separation of PVF worker binaries, dedicated puppet workers
      are not needed for tests anymore. The production workers can be used
      instead, avoiding some code duplication and decreasing complexity.
      
      The changes also make it possible to further refactor the code to
      isolate workers completely.

      * PVF: Don't dispute on missing artifact
      
      A dispute should never be raised if the local cache doesn't provide a certain
      artifact. You can not dispute based on this reason, as it is a local hardware
      issue and not related to the candidate to check.
      
      Design:
      
      Currently we assume that if we prepared an artifact, it remains there on-disk
      until we prune it, i.e. we never check again if it's still there.
      
      We can change it so that instead of artifact-not-found triggering a dispute, we
      retry once (like we do for AmbiguousWorkerDeath, except we don't dispute if it
      still doesn't work). And when enqueuing an execute job, we check for the
      artifact on-disk, and start preparation if not found.

      * Fix a couple of potential minor data races.
      
      First data race was due to logging in the CPU monitor thread even if the
      job (other thread) finished. It can technically finish before or after the log.
      
      Maybe best would be to move this log to the `select!`s, where we are guaranteed
      to have chosen the timed-out branch, although there would be a bit of
      duplication.
      
      Also, it was possible for this thread to complete before we executed
      `finished_tx.send` in the other thread, which would trigger an error as the
      receiver has already been dropped. And right now, such a spurious error from
      `send` would be returned even if the job otherwise succeeded.
